6 tips to Plan a Destination Wedding

Planning a destination wedding can be a thrilling and exciting experience, but it can also be overwhelming and stressful if you’re not prepared. Here are some tips to help you plan the best destination wedding possible:

  1. Choose the right location: Consider factors such as the couple’s interests, the weather, the cost, and the accessibility for guests. Research different destinations and compare options to find the best fit for your vision.
  2. Book early: Start planning as far in advance as possible, especially if you’re planning to get married during peak season. This will give you more time to research and compare options, and it will also give your guests plenty of notice to make travel arrangements.
  3. Research local laws and customs: Make sure you understand the legal requirements for getting married in your chosen destination, as well as any cultural or traditional customs that you should be aware of.
  4. Choose a reputable planner: If you’re planning a destination wedding, it can be helpful to work with a local planner who has experience with weddings in the area and can help you navigate any challenges that may arise.
  5. Communicate with your guests: Keep your guests informed about the details of your wedding and provide them with any necessary information, such as travel itineraries and accommodations.
  6. Don’t forget about the little things: Don’t get so caught up in the big picture that you forget about the little details that will make your wedding special. Think about things like music, flowers, and decor to add a personal touch to your celebration.

By following these tips, you can plan a destination wedding that is both memorable and stress-free.
